Role Description
This is a full-time, on-site role located in Bridgend for a Motor Vehicle Mechanic/Technician. The Motor Vehicle Mechanic/Technician will be responsible for vehicle maintenance and repair, troubleshooting mechanical issues, and working with heavy equipment. Day-to-day tasks include conducting routine inspections, performing diagnostic tests, and implementing effective repair solutions. The candidate may also be required to oversee junior staff and ensure compliance with health and safety regulations.
Qualifications
- Vehicle Maintenance, Maintenance & Repair skills
- Troubleshooting skills for identifying and resolving mechanical issues
- Experience with Heavy Equipment
- Supervisory Skills
- Strong attention to detail and problem-solving abilities
- Excellent communication and organizational skills
- Relevant certifications or qualifications in automotive engineering or mechanics
- Previous experience in a similar role preferred
